Brano, BSc. DOMP, CPT, is passionate about helping people improve their quality of life using a holistic approach. He believes a positive impact can be made through education on the importance of active, healthy lifestyles. He obtained a bachelor's degree of Sport Science in Slovakia, and moved to Canada to further pursue his passion and education. In 2018, Brano graduated from the National Academy of Osteopathy in Toronto and became a Registered Manual Osteopath. Additionally, he recently finished the disability management certificate at the University of Fredericton.
Brano has extensive knowledge in personal training, and he uses a Neurokinetic Therapy approach treating various injuries, strains, and sprains. Through reprogramming movement patterns in the motor control center in the cerebellum he is able to reduce compensatory movement patterns, as well as treating musculoskeletal conditions such as OA, OP, and chronic pain management.

Zorica's approach of teaching Pilates is to simply bring out the best in your body with accurate results! By using the Pilates Method's fundamental six principles (breath/centering/concentration/control/flow/precision) and exercises integrated with one another, results consist of strength, grace, balance, and ease.
Zorica is a fully certified Pilates instructor - Comprehensive Global repertoire (mat & apparatus) through BASI Pilates. Zorica has a background of 25 years in the fitness industry, an international gymnastics career, and is a two-time gold winning Olympian. A well-rounded knowledge of technical precision in anatomical movement and a decade of professional training has prepared her for the demands and discipline of the Pilates Method. This Method has become her way of life. As a Pilates instructor, Zorica keeps her studies relevant with the most current innovations and body sciences by incorporating PNF, cross-chain training, and fascial studies with a particular focus on functional movement.
Regardless of age or physical condition, including pre and post-surgery, athletic conditioning, geriatric mobility, or those participating in chosen sport activity, Zorica encourages her students to take control of their own practice. This is done by using descriptive cues to ensure that every student is comfortable performing the movements, with safety being the top priority at all times.
